Kinds of Ovens
Comprehending the various types of ovens on the market is essential in making a notified purchase. Below are the most common types readily available today:
Type of Oven | Description |
---|---|
Conventional Ovens | Standard ovens that use either gas or electric heat. Ideal for baking and roasting. |
Convection Ovens | Function fans that flow hot air for even cooking. Great for baking numerous trays at the same time. |
Steam Ovens | Inject steam into the cooking chamber, protecting moisture and flavor, making them outstanding for cooking veggies and fish. |
Wall Ovens | Built into the wall and maximize kitchen space. Offered in single and double setups. |
Microwave Ovens | Not simply for reheating, these can likewise bake and grill, making them a flexible option for smaller sized kitchen areas. |
Induction Ovens | Use electromagnetic fields to heat pots and pans straight, offering faster cooking times and more precise temperature level control. |
Key Features to Consider
When searching for an oven, potential purchasers ought to consider a variety of features that will boost usability and fit their cooking needs:
- Size and Capacity: Consider the size of your kitchen and how much cooking you typically do. Ovens come in different sizes, so it's vital to choose one that fits comfortably in your space while providing enough capacity for your cooking needs.

- Reduce of Cleaning: Ovens with self-cleaning features or easy-to-clean interiors can conserve effort and time. Think about models with non-stick finishes or detachable parts that are dishwashing machine safe.
- Control Features: Digital controls and smart technology can make cooking easier. Search for an oven with functions such as delay-timers, temperature probes, and pre-programmed cooking choices.
- Safety Features: Modern ovens often include kid locks, touch-safe surfaces, and temperature level controls to avoid getting too hot and accidents.
- Design and Aesthetics: Aesthetics play a considerable role in kitchen style. Choose an oven that complements your kitchen's design, whether it's conventional, contemporary, or farmhouse.

Often Asked Questions (FAQs)
- What is the average life expectancy of an oven?The typical lifespan of an oven can differ extensively but generally varies from 10 to 15 years depending on the type and quality of the home appliance.
- Should I buy a gas or electric oven?This mainly depends upon individual choices and the existing infrastructure in your house. Gas ovens tend to heat faster and provide moisture, while electric ovens frequently deliver more even heating and are typically simpler to clean up.
- How do I keep my oven to ensure it lasts longer?Regular cleaning, avoiding extreme chemicals, and following the producer's guidelines for operation can assist extend the life of your oven.
- What size oven do I need for my household?As a general guideline, a basic oven can accommodate little to medium-sized families. However, if you host large gatherings, a double oven or a larger capacity model may be worth the investment.
- Are wise ovens worth it?Smart ovens use convenience and advanced cooking options, allowing users to control them from another location via smart device apps. However, whether they're worth it or not depends on private way of life and cooking practices.
